How much do union laborer j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 13, 2026, the average hourly pay for union laborer in Worcester, MA is $19.03,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.06 and $21.11 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a union laborer do?

A union laborer performs manual labor tasks on construction sites, such as loading materials, digging trenches, and assisting skilled tradespeople. They often work with tools and equipment, follow safety protocols, and may need certifications like OSHA training. Their work supports the building and maintenance of infrastructure and buildings.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a union laborer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Union Laborer, you need physical stamina, basic construction knowledge, and a high school diploma or equivalent, often supplemented by union apprenticeship programs. Familiarity with hand and power tools, safety equipment, and compliance with OSHA standards is typically required. Dependability, teamwork, and a strong work ethic are important soft skills for excelling in this role. These abilities ensure safe, efficient work and effective collaboration on construction sites, contributing to overall project success.

What is a union laborer?

Union laborers are skilled workers who perform a variety of tasks on construction sites, including demolition, excavation, building, and site preparation, and are members of a labor union. Being part of a union provides them with collective bargaining power, which helps secure better wages, benefits, and working conditions. Union laborers often receive specialized training and are required to follow strict safety standards. Their work is essential to the completion of many large-scale building and infrastructure projects.

How do you get into a union laborer?

To become a union laborer, you typically need to complete an apprenticeship program that combines on-the-job training with classroom instruction, often requiring a high school diploma or equivalent. You can apply through a local union or apprenticeship program, meet physical and age requirements, and sometimes pass an aptitude test or interview before being accepted into the program.
